Software Engineer II

ChewyBoston, MA

About The Position

Our Opportunity: Chewy is looking for a Software Engineer to join our Supply Chain Simulation technology team. In this role, you will combine an understanding of software development, simulation, and data transformation. As a Software Engineer, you will play a meaningful part in crafting, implementing, and deploying data and simulation systems to support our business and address critical problems for our Fulfillment Operations. The ideal candidate will understand our business goals, collaborate across cross-functional teams, innovate rapidly, and deliver high-quality and high-value functionality. You will have the chance to create and develop Data, Optimization and Simulation solutions best suited for different business problems and build engineering pipelines to streamline model deployment and testing. Does this sound like you? If so, we would love to hear from you! Come join the Pack!

Requirements

  • Bachelor's degree (Computer Science or similar technical field of study preferred), or equivalent work experience.
  • 3+ years of professional software development experience building distributed and highly performant systems.
  • Strong proficiency in Python and SQL.
  • Excellent problem-solving skills and the ability to work independently in a fast-paced environment.
  • Proven ability to analyze business requirements and translate them into code.
  • Experience building high-quality systems, including unit testing and continuous integration / continuous deployment (CI/CD) pipelines.
  • Excellent oral and written communication skills including collaboration with both technical and non-technical customers.
  • Strong time management and organizational skills.
  • Team-oriented and have a customer first approach.

Nice To Haves

  • Experience with AWS Cloud Technologies.
  • Experience with containerization & orchestration tools (e.g. Docker, Kubernetes) and Infrastructure as Code tools (e.g., Terraform, CloudFormation).
  • Experience in Supply-chain and/or exposure with Operational Research space.

Responsibilities

  • Design, develop and implement highly performant optimization systems with large data volumes.
  • Collaborate with multi-functional teams, including data scientists, software engineers, and domain experts, to understand requirements and deliver effective solutions.
  • Solve data quality issues and identify root causes.
  • Write clean, maintainable, and efficient code following procedures in software engineering.
  • Follow a development approach that prioritizes writing tests first and ensure that all code undergoes a detailed peer review process.
  • Debug critical hard-to-solve production issues across services and tech stacks.
  • Advocate for and implement software engineering protocols, including version control, code reviews, unit testing, and continuous integration / continuous deployment (CI/CD) pipelines.

Benefits

  • 401k
  • new hire and annual equity grant
  • annual bonus
  • medical/Rx insurance
  • vision insurance
  • dental insurance
  • life insurance
  • disability insurance
  • hospital indemnity insurance
  • critical illness insurance
  • accident insurance
  • parental leave
  • family services benefits
  • backup dependent care
  • flexible spending accounts
  • telemedicine
  • pet adoption reimbursement
  • employee assistance program
  • discounts including 10% off pet insurance and 20% off at Chewy.com
  • unlimited PTO, subject to manager approval
  • six paid holidays per year
  • paid sick and family leave in compliance with applicable state and local regulations
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service